Top 5 Hack and Slash Apps Performance in Ireland Q3 2022

In the third quarter of 2022, the top five hack and slash applications in Ireland showcased diverse performance trends across we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. The data, sourced from Sensor Tower, provides valuable insights into the market dynamics of these popular apps.

Punishing: Gray Raven experienced fluctuations in its weekly revenue, peaking at around $2.3K in mid-July before gradually declining to approximately $216 by the end of September. Weekly downloads saw a slight increase in late July, reaching 63, but dropped to as low as 2 in mid-September. Active users showed a consistent decline from 161 in late July to 96 by the end of September.

Honkai Impact 3rd demonstrated a steady weekly revenue with significant spikes, reaching about $1.8K in mid-September. Weekly downloads remained relatively stable, peaking at 122 in late June and maintaining an average of around 64 towards the end of the quarter. Active users exhibited slight fluctuations, starting at 359 in late June and ending at 285 at the close of September.

MARVEL Future Fight showed a notable peak in weekly revenue, hitting $801 in mid-September. Downloads peaked at 151 in late July and remained consistent around the 100 mark for most of the quarter. Active users saw a peak of 1.1K in mid-September, indicating a strong engagement towards the end of the quarter.

Disney Mirrorverse had a high initial weekly revenue of $987 in late June, which gradually decreased to around $289 by the end of September. Downloads saw a significant drop from 1.6K in late June to 144 by the end of the quarter. Active users also declined from 1.7K in late June to 658 by the end of September.

Pocket Knights2: Dragon War maintained a consistent weekly revenue throughout the quarter, averaging around $159. However, there were no recorded downloads, and active user data was not available for this period.
